Charulata Name Meaning & Origin
Origin & Sound
Charulata is a girl name of Sanskrit origin, meaning "Beautiful creeper vine, graceful woman". It is spelled with 9 letters — 4 vowels and 5 consonants. The name opens on a emotional note and closes with a spiritual one. Familiar short forms and variants include Charu.
Popularity & Notable Bearers
Notable people named Charulata include Charulata (Satyajit Ray's iconic film title character).
